Group 1: Industry Context - The rapid development of AI technology has made computing power a core production factor, but high leasing costs for computing power severely restrict the growth of startups [3]. - Traditional models require companies to continuously pay for computing power, which consumes resources that could be allocated to research and market development, prompting the introduction of the "computing power equity" model [3]. Group 2: Innovative Model - The "Cloud Teng Plan" innovatively redefines computing power from a "service cost" to a "strategic capital," allowing for the assessment of computing power value based on research and development needs, which is then converted into equity for the company [3]. - This model transforms the relationship between companies and service providers, alleviating cash flow pressure and creating a "community of interests" between both parties [3]. Group 3: Strategic Implications - The collaboration creates a win-win situation for enterprises, platforms, and local industries, with the company transitioning from a "tenant" to a "partner," reducing fixed costs while gaining technical support and industry resources [3]. - For the computing power provider, this represents a strategic shift from being a "landlord" to an "industry partner," allowing for shared growth benefits and promoting regional AI industry clustering [3]. - The "Cloud Teng Plan" serves as a magnet showcasing the city's innovation capabilities, reinforcing Chengdu's label as a "new high ground for the artificial intelligence industry" [3]. Group 4: Future Outlook - The computing power provider plans to open this model to more high-growth AI companies and aims to establish industry standards for "capitalizing computing power," fostering a new ecosystem for the AI industry that is open and mutually beneficial [3].
